Position Summary
Functioning as part of the coordinated service delivery team, the Outreach Worker works proactively with new and existing clients, offering a range of support and recovery services, within as existing service plan and on an as-needed basis. The Outreach Worker is a relationship-builder and advocate and provides services in a non-judgmental and culturally appropriate manner, helping clients to build new skills and achieve their goals.
This Program works within an Assertive Community Treatment Model and utilizes the Housing First Principles from a social justice orientation which includes harm reduction, pro-choice, social determinants of health, human rights, social development, population health, health equality and trauma informed, client centered practice.
